Fundamental Principles of Apple’s Privacy Rules and Policies

Privacy by Design

Apple emphasizes integrating privacy into every stage of app development. This means designing features that minimize data collection, limit access to sensitive information, and enable users to control their data. For instance, apps are encouraged to request only the necessary permissions, reducing potential attack vectors and compliance burdens.

Mandatory Privacy Disclosures

Apple introduced privacy labels that require developers to transparently report data practices in the App Store. These labels serve as nutritional information, helping users make informed choices. Implementing these disclosures involves additional development effort to accurately categorize data types and usage, impacting project timelines and costs.

App Clips and Minimal Data Collection

Apple’s App Clips offer a lightweight, privacy-conscious way for users to try apps without downloading full versions. They limit data collection by restricting app functionality, which simplifies compliance and reduces associated costs—an example of how privacy-centric features can be both user-friendly and cost-efficient.

How Privacy Regulations Impact App Developer Costs

Cost Aspect Description
Development Time Implementing privacy features, such as encryption and consent dialogs, requires additional planning and coding, extending project timelines.
Resource Allocation Designing privacy-compliant interfaces and conducting privacy impact assessments demand specialized skills, increasing staffing or consulting costs.
Ongoing Maintenance Regular updates, audits, and policy adjustments incur recurring expenses to ensure continued compliance.

For example, integrating encryption protocols like TLS or end-to-end encryption in messaging apps adds initial development costs but significantly enhances user trust and reduces legal risks—illustrating the balance between upfront investment and long-term benefits.

Comparison with Google Play Store Policies

While both Apple and Google emphasize transparency, their enforcement mechanisms and developer responsibilities differ. Google’s policies require similar privacy disclosures and data handling practices, but often with different implementation nuances. For instance, Google Play mandates data safety sections, which, like Apple’s privacy labels, inform users about data collection but may impose varying documentation efforts.

Developers producing apps for both platforms often face the challenge of maintaining compliance across diverse frameworks, leading to increased testing and documentation costs. A comparative overview:

Aspect Apple Google
Mandatory disclosures Privacy labels in App Store Data safety section in Google Play
Enforcement Strict review process, app removals for non-compliance Periodic audits, policy updates
Developer Responsibility Accurate disclosure, user transparency Similar, with added emphasis on data security practices

Case Study: App Clips and Privacy Efficiency

Apple’s App Clips exemplify how privacy-focused features can streamline development costs. By limiting app functionality to specific tasks—such as ordering food or paying for transit—developers reduce the scope of data collection and minimize compliance complexity. This targeted approach not only enhances user privacy but also decreases the resources needed for privacy assessments and disclosures.

For instance, a food delivery app implementing an App Clip might only collect location data during the ordering process, avoiding broader data access. This focused data collection simplifies compliance, reduces potential breach points, and accelerates user onboarding, ultimately saving development and support costs.
